About Pascal Kamdem
Pascal Kamdem is a scholar working on Building and Construction, Polymers and Plastics, Biomedical Engineering, Materials Chemistry and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, having authored 20 papers that have together received 465 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Wood Treatment and Properties (6 papers), Supercapacitor Materials and Fabrication (5 papers), Natural Fiber Reinforced Composites (4 papers), MXene and MAX Phase Materials (4 papers), Advanced Sensor and Energy Harvesting Materials (3 papers), Lignin and Wood Chemistry (3 papers), Biological Activity of Diterpenoids and Biflavonoids (2 papers) and Cultural Heritage Materials Analysis (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(195 citations), Polymers and Plastics (76 citations), Materials Chemistry (232 citations), Building and Construction (68 citations) and Biomedical Engineering (134 citations). Pascal Kamdem has collaborated with scholars based in United States, China and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Xiaojuan Jin, Yue Li, Canping Pan, Bernard Riedl, Radu Crăciun, Jingping Zhang, A. Adnot, James W. Hanover, Stéphane Dumarçay and Kévin Candelier. Their work appears in journals such as Holzforschung, Polymer Composites, Journal of Wood Chemistry and Technology, Dalton Transactions and Sustainable Energy & Fuels.
